Control arm bushing tool

Has anyone used this tool to put the bushings on the lower control arms

Yes but if you have a room a dead blow hammer and some lube is easier and faster

Save your money you don't need it. You can use a pry bar to get the stock ones off. But if your installing powerflex bushings they will slide right on without any tools.

Working as a tech for a mini dealer and replacing these on a weekly basis. I can agree with Way. The race bushings that I put on my own car was the best thing I have done. Easy to put on and easy to remove later for re-greasing when needed
